Is it Worth it?

The Dell Inspiron 15 3530 is a solid choice for professionals or students seeking a reliable, fast, and spacious laptop that can handle multitasking without unnecessary frills. With its 10-core Intel Core i7-1355U processor, 16 GB of RAM, and 1 TB SSD, it shines in business and everyday performance. The 15.6-inch full HD touchscreen is bright and responsive, making it perfect for note-taking and casual use. However, the display's brightness and color depth could be improved, and outdoor visibility isn't ideal. Overall, if you prioritize productivity over gaming or high-end visuals, the Inspiron 15 3530 is a great investment, offering standout storage, processing power, and a useful touchscreen experience.

Build

The Dell Inspiron 15 3530's design is clean and functional, with a subtle matte finish and slim profile that makes it suitable for both work and casual use. The build quality feels durable, with a comfortable hinge and keyboard deck that doesn't flex easily. While not premium like the XPS line, the machine exudes a professional look without drawing attention. It's lightweight yet solid enough to handle daily wear and tear. The plastic construction is mostly unobtrusive, though it may feel less substantial than aluminum-clad competitors. Overall, the build quality is solid, if unremarkable, making it a practical choice for professionals and students on the go. Display

The 15.6-inch full HD touchscreen display is a highlight of the Dell Inspiron 15 3530. It's bright and responsive, making navigation easy whether you're scrolling through documents or tapping through presentations. The 1080p resolution is sharp enough for work and media consumption, although it could benefit from better brightness and color depth. Outdoor visibility can be a challenge due to the limited backlighting. Additionally, the display lacks support for a stylus, which might be a drawback for those who prefer more precise input methods. Performance

The Dell Inspiron 15 3530 delivers solid performance with its Intel Core i7-1355U processor, capable of handling multitasking with ease. The 10-core chip excels in efficiency and productivity tasks, making it perfect for professionals juggling spreadsheets, Zoom calls, and browser tabs. With 16 GB of RAM and a 1 TB SSD, the laptop stays fast and responsive, making it ideal for business use and everyday activities. Connectivity

The Dell Inspiron 15 3530's connectivity options are adequate for everyday use. It features two USB-A ports, one USB-C port with display output, an HDMI port, and an Ethernet jack, making it easy to connect peripherals and transfer files. The laptop also supports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th 5.0, ensuring seamless internet connectivity. However, the lack of a Thunderbolt 3 port or a third USB-A port may limit its appeal for power users. Features

The Dell Inspiron 15 3530 boasts a 15.6-inch full HD touchscreen, making navigation effortless. The Intel Core i7-1355U processor and 16 GB of RAM provide smooth multitasking capabilities, ideal for professionals and students. A 1 TB SSD offers ample storage, ensuring quick boot times and file transfers. Intel Iris XE graphics handle office work and light content creation well. A 1080p webcam ensures clear video calls, while Windows 11 Pro provides robust security features like Bit Locker encryption and remote desktop support.
